Spawn usually is a mixture of sawdust and mycelium, the “human body” from the fungal organism that decomposes a substrate, grows – and when conditions are ideal – generates the reproductive structures we try to eat: mushrooms. The remarkable thing about mycelium is you can take a piece of it, introduce it to an proper substrate, and it'll increase. Then you can use as spawn to inoculate additional issues to generate mushrooms.
Blend just one portion coco coir with one section vermiculite. Considering that coco coir commonly will come to be a brick, you’ll must insert boiling h2o (an equivalent amount of money towards the dry components). Be sure the combination cools in advance of introducing your spawn.
Hardwood gas pellets are an awesome option if you can’t get sawdust simply. These pellets are very simple to utilize and also have reliable humidity content, which makes them excellent for novices.
Amendments, such as biochar, minerals, and nitrogen, are usually mixed in While using the carbon supply; these can boost produce and chemical expression from the mushrooms. After you buy a ready to fruit block, the provider’s recipe optimizes the carbon resource, the C:N ratio, and the particular amendments for his or her strains. In case you make your personal mushroom substrate, you may optimize it for your preferences, and on supplies you may have on hand.

Cleanliness assists end unwelcome organisms from affecting mushroom progress. This is applicable throughout the total system, from preparing the substrate to harvesting the mushrooms. Wiping down surfaces with 70% isopropyl Liquor is mostly ample for the home grower.
Most read more mushrooms that mature well on logs may also expand on hardwood sawdust pellets or vice versa, considering that both equally are Wooden-centered substrates.
Hardwood sawdust will work best when combined with Wooden chips. This results in the perfect construction for mycelial expansion.
